74 /100 SCHELMSEWEG 89
“Huge museumpark with endless parking space. The park has its own tramline with vintage trams, horse coaches, old styles of housing and production processes. One of those is a beer brewery, a small museum about beer making in general and an active brewery with beer to sample. Great (outdoor) museum, free access with museumkaart and free for kids under 4 yrs old too. Enough to see, do, eat and drink to spend an entire day. Super crowded in winter holidays but since its so big that doesn’t matter much at all, and the seasonal attractions like ice skating and winter market make it all the more charming. The park is divided in different area’s focussing on different things (village, trade, farming, etc). At the brewery I could only sample one beer, a small bar nearby had 4 beers on tap and bottles for sale. The shop at the entry/exit has about 4 different brews for takeout in large bottles in a €7-€9 price range. Brews are now exclusively sold in the museum, no longer in shops in the region, I was told by a wine/beer shopowner. We had a great time, if you’re just into it for the beer don’t bother. Museum shop is past the entrance, so you need an entry ticket.“
